The Effect of Training, Employee Benefits, and Incentives on Job Satisfaction and Commitment in Part-time Hotel Employees
Author: Caitlin D. Jaworski
Publisher:
ISBN:
Category : Employee retention
Languages : en
Pages : 70
Book Description
Hotels that provide inadequate training exacerbate staff turnover. This is particularly true for part-time employees who make up 25% of the labor force in the hospitality industry. The purpose of this research is to study the effects of training and select employee motivators including incentives and benefits on part-time hotel employees' job satisfaction and overall job commitment. Data were collected using survey methodology from part-time employees at four different properties in Northeast Ohio. Data was analyzed to determine connections between training and job commitment. Results can help hotel managers design effective training programs and offer incentives that part-time employees value most in order to reduce turnover.

The Employee Benefits Answer Book
Author: Rebecca Mazin
Publisher: John Wiley & Sons
ISBN: 0470912448
Category : Business & Economics
Languages : en
Pages : 272
Book Description
THE EMPLOYEE BENEFITS ANSWER BOOK This go-to resource contains the most reliable information needed to answer questions about employee benefits that arise in day-to-day business. Complex and ambiguous topics are illustrated with concrete examples that can help make informed, sound decisions, and ultimately, the ability to ask better questions. Written by Rebecca Mazin an expert in human resource policies and procedures the book addresses the most commonly asked benefits questions including: How many vacation days do employees get? What's the difference between a POS and an HSA? Is offering check-ups and eye exams enough? What's involved in flexible spending accounts? What do I need to know about 401(k) and Non-Qualified Plans? Do employees expect life insurance and disability? From EAP to concierge services, what else do employees want? How does COBRA work and what else do I need to do? What can employers do to rein in benefits costs? The book also highlights specific practice examples that are "worth repeating," or "better forgotten," and includes a wide-variety of checklists and charts. The Employee Benefits Answer Book is organized by topic and arranged in a question and answer format making it easy to zero in on a particular subject. Using this important book, employers can create coherent policies based on a clear understanding of all benefits.
